The American economic system is organized around a basically private-enterprise, market- oriented economy in which consumers largely determine what shall be produced by spending their money in the marketplace for those goods and services that they want most. Private businessmen ,
striving to make profits , produce these goods and services in competition with other businessmen ;
and the profit motive , operating under competitive pressures , largely determines how these goods and services are produced. Thus, in the American eoonomic system it is the demand of individual consumers , coupled with the desire of businessmen to maximize profits and the desire of individu - als to maximize their incomes, that together determine what shall be produced and how resources are used to produce it.
An important factor in a market-oriented economy is the mechanism by which consumer de- mands can be expressed and responded to by producers. In the American economy, this mecha- nism is provided bv a price system, a process in which prices rise and fall in response to relative demands of consumers and supplies offered by seller-producers.
